How To Fix KM367 - Profit center account determination is not possible.


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: KM - Error messages for Profit Center Accounting

  • Message number: 367

  • Message text: Profit center account determination is not possible.

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    For internal goods movements, the system must write new document items
    in Profit Center Accounting. For this the system must find an account,
    but it could not find any here.

    System Response

    You cannot post the document.

    How to fix this error?

    Check the settings in the account determination table for Profit Center
    Accounting with the following arguments:
    Controlling area: &V1&
    Material type: &V2&
    Valuation class: &V3&
    Valuation area modification constant: &V4&
    <DS:TRAN.0KEK>Maintain account determination</>

    The SAP error message KM367, which states "Profit center account determination is not possible," typically occurs in the context of Profit Center Accounting (PCA) when the system is unable to determine the appropriate account for a profit center during a transaction. This can happen for several reasons, and understanding the cause is crucial for resolving the issue.

    Causes of KM367 Error

    1. Missing Account Assignment: The profit center may not have a corresponding account assignment in the configuration settings. This can happen if the profit center is newly created or if the account assignment has not been properly maintained.

    2. Incorrect Configuration: The configuration for profit center accounting may not be set up correctly. This includes settings in the controlling area, profit center, and account determination.

    3. Missing Master Data: The necessary master data (such as cost elements or profit center master data) may be incomplete or missing.

    4. Account Determination Settings: The account determination settings for the specific transaction type may not be defined correctly in the system.

    5. Transaction Type Issues: The transaction type being used may not be compatible with the profit center accounting settings.
